Ref

"You should file the original with the clerk of the court in the county where the case was filed and keep a copy for your records. This must be done within 20 days of receiving the supplemental petition."



Thanks

socrateaser

>"You should file the original with the clerk of the court in
>the county where the case was filed and keep a copy for your
>records. This must be done within 20 days of receiving the
>supplemental petition."

I would read that to mean no later than the end of the 20th calander day -- counting day #1 as the day after you were served.
